Definition
'The same thing happened to me.' is a common English collocation. I experienced the same event or situation as you.
happen + to + someone/something
“The same thing happened to me.”
Examples
- After she described her frustrating day, John said, "Oh no, the same thing happened to me last week!"
- He looked at me with understanding and muttered, "The same thing happened to me yesterday."
- When I told him about my car trouble, he nodded, "The same thing happened to me a few months ago."

- Don't worry, you're not alone; the same thing happened to me when I started this job.
- I know exactly how you feel because the same thing happened to me during my first presentation.
- She looked relieved when I mentioned the glitch, "Thank goodness, the same thing happened to me too!"
- He couldn't believe it when I explained the mix-up; apparently, the same thing had happened to him before.
- If the same thing were to happen to me again, I would handle it differently.
- It's strange, but the same thing always seems to happen to me whenever I try to use that program.
- Every time I use this old printer, the same thing happens to me: it jams.
